About PassMark

PassMark CPU Mark evaluates processor speed through complex mathematical computations. It provides a reliable metric to compare multi-core performance, where higher scores indicate faster processing for multitasking, gaming, and heavy workloads.

Intel

Pentium III 1200

The Pentium III 1200 is manufactured by Intel. It was released in 2007-01-01. It is based on the Tualatin (2000−2002) architecture. It features 1 cores and 1 threads. Max frequency: 1.2 GHz. L3 cache: 0 kB. L2 cache: 256 kB. Built on 130 nm process technology. Socket: PGA370. Thermal design power (TDP): 30 Watt. Passmark benchmark score: 195 points. Launch price was $69.

AMD

Ryzen 7 7800X3D

The Ryzen 7 7800X3D is manufactured by AMD. It was released in 4 January 2023 (2 years ago). It is based on the Raphael (Zen4) (2022−2023) architecture. It features 8 cores and 16 threads. Base frequency is 4.4 GHz, with boost up to 5 GHz. L3 cache: 96 MB (total). L2 cache: 1 MB (per core). Built on 5 nm process technology. Socket: AM5. Thermal design power (TDP): 120 Watt. Memory support: DDR5-5200. Passmark benchmark score: 34,293 points. Launch price was $449.
